TECHNICAL COMPETENCIES — STABILITY

  • Mass, Geometry & Hydrostatics: Estimation of lightweight ship mass at concept stage based on reference vessels. Preparation of main‑dimension variants with respect to payload, buoyancy, and stability criteria. Development of 2D drawings representing principal ship dimensions. Creation of theoretical hull lines for hydrostatic analyses and tank configuration work. Development of tank layout ensuring compliance with technical specifications, including 2D tank drawings.
  • Watertight Subdivision: Preparation of watertight bulkhead plans and collision bulkhead positioning. Development of watertight subdivision drawings and arrangement of non‑watertight elements. Optimization of watertight subdivision based on damage‑flooding analysis. Comparison of alternative tank arrangements and subdivision concepts.
  • Stability Calculations: Creation of a stability model based on the general arrangement and vessel geometry. Conducting intact stability calculations for defined loading conditions. Conducting damage stability calculations. Preparation of stability reports (intact & damage). Development of safety margin summaries for intact and damage stability. Creation of tank sounding tables based on approved tank arrangements. Preparation of input data for longitudinal strength calculations. Execution of an inclining experiment and preparation of the corresponding report (lightship weight & center of gravity).
     

TECHNICAL COMPETENCIES — STRENGTH CALCULATION (STRUCTURAL ANALYSIS):

  • Structural Calculations & Load Assessment: ability to calculate geometric section parameters (neutral axis, moments of inertia, section moduli). Ability to perform analytical stress calculations for basic structural systems. Verification and documentation of stress types based on computational models. Creation of shear force and bending moment envelopes in line with project requirements.
  • Structural Assessment & Design: Selection of structural scantlings in accordance with project requirements. Assessment of hull structural strength based on design assumptions and requirements. Evaluation of component load‑carrying capacity and structural flexibility. Development of optimization proposals to improve strength, reduce weight, or lower cost.
  • Finite Element Method (FEM/MES): Development of global, local, and zonal FEM models. Execution and interpretation of FEM‑based strength analyses. Execution of local FEM analyses. Ability to perform non‑linear, dynamic, and thermal calculations. Ability to conduct fatigue analyses for ships and marine structures.
  • Specialized Engineering Calculations: Docking calculations and assessment of support reactions on hull structure. Lifting and transportation calculations for ships and marine structures.

Damen was established by two brothers back in 1927. Today, with more than 12,000 employees, operating over 35 shipbuilding and repair yards, the Damen Shipyards Group has earned a leading position in the shipbuilding world. We are an international company that is, at heart, still a family business with family values and a deep respect for our maritime heritage. It is our aim to combine our proven standardisation with the innovations of digitalisation to become the world’s most sustainable shipbuilder

Newbuild

Damen has delivered more than 6,500 vessels in 100 countries and delivers some 175 vessels annually to customers worldwide. Damen’s focus on standardisation, modular construction and keeping vessels on stock leads to short delivery times, low total cost of ownership and reliable performance. We offer a wide range of products including tugs, naval and patrol vessels, high speed craft, ferries, dredging, offshore vessels and superyachts.

Shiprepair & conversion

Damen Shiprepair & Conversion (DSC) has a worldwide network of 18 repair and conversion yards with drydocks ranging up to 420 x 80 metres. DSC yards have extensive experience – completing more than 1,300 projects every year, from normal drydockings for scheduled maintenance to damage repair, right up to extensive refit and conversion projects.

Services

Being active in the maritime industry demands continuous vessel reliability. For nearly all vessel types Damen offers a broad range of services, including maintenance, spare parts delivery, training and the transfer of shipbuilding know-how.

Components

Damen is also specialised in the design and production of various marine components including propeller nozzles, rudders, special towing winches, anchors, anchor chains and steel works.
